ABOUT THE ROLE
As a Staff Product Designer at Fox One, you will be a pivotal, highly influential leader. You will own the end-to-end design strategy and execution for our most complex and strategic products, with a heavy emphasis on emerging technologies and AI-driven experiences. This role demands a visionary leader responsible for setting the bar for design quality, mentoring designers, and driving consensus across executive and cross-functional teams.
A SNAPSHOT OF Y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ES
Drive vision and prototyping for frontier, AI-driven experiences, shaping how users discover and consume content through adaptive, agentic ecosystems.
Translate ambiguous, complex problem spaces into clear, executable design plans and actionable insights that directly influence long-range product strategy and investment.
Conduct deep market and competitive analysis to ensure Fox One maintains a future-forward, dominant market position.
Define and drive the long-term design vision for a major product area, balancing Fox One's principles with partner constraints.
Lead the design of complex features and systems from concept to launch, producing high-quality artifacts including user flows, wireframes, prototypes, and high-fidelity blue-sky frames.
Partner closely with Product and Engineering to drive alignment and advance strategic, performance-tied initiatives.
Champion and contribute extensively to the evolution of the Fox Design System, ensuring unparalleled consistency, scalability, and efficiency across all products.
Act as a force multiplier for the design organization, providing critique, mentorship, and guidance to mid-level and junior designers to elevate the overall design craft.
Present compelling design narratives and strategic recommendations clearly and persuasively to senior leadership and executive stakeholders.
WHAT YOU WILL NEED
Experience: 7+ years of professional experience in Product Design shipping 0-1 products, with significant tenure operating at a Senior level. Experience with OTT design is highly desirable.
Portfolio: A strong, well-organized portfolio demonstrating expertise in designing complex products and D2C platforms at scale. Please note: Applications without a portfolio that clearly demonstrates these specific skills will not be considered.
AI & Innovation: Specific experience in designing AI-driven experiences is highly desirable but not required.
Launch & Growth: Proven track record of launching successful app features and driving their continued growth through data-informed iteration and optimization.
System Thinking: Proven expertise in developing, maintaining, and leveraging comprehensive design systems to drive velocity and consistency.
Technical Fluency: Comfortable navigating deep technical discussions and constraints with engineering partners; fluent in modern design/prototyping tools (e.g., Figma, Framer).
Impact: A history of shipping impactful, user-centered products that have successfully achieved key business outcomes.
